Cung Le and Veronica Ngo join forces for ‘The Target’
Veronica Ngo Thanh Van – multi-talented star of the The Rebel, Clash and the upcoming Furie – is teaming up with former MMA fighter-turned-action star Cung Le (Europe Raiders, Savage Dog) for a Vietnamese martial arts thriller titled The Target (aka Mục Tiêu Chết). Unfortunately, Ngo will only be producing, and will not appear in The Target. Korea’s ‘The Villainess’ is getting a U.S. TV series remake
Skybound Entertainment (The Walking Dead) and Korea’s Contents Panda are adapting the 2017 Korean actioner The Villainess into an English-language TV series. Jeong Byeong-gil (Confession of Murder), who directed the original film, is on board to helm the series’ pilot. According to Deadline, the series, also titled The Villainess, follows Anes, who was kidnapped from her home in Korea and raised as a deadly assassin in Los Angeles. HBO Asia to air two New kung fu films early next Year
Following HBO Asia’s successful 2016 release of Master of the Shadowless Kick: Wong Kei-Ying and Master of the Drunken Fist: Beggar So, the network, along with China Movie Channel, will be releasing Master of the White Crane Fist: Wong Yan-Lam and Master of the Nine Dragon Fist: Wong Ching-Ho on February 20th and 21st, 2019, respectively.
